Basic Lemon Sauce

The best lemon sauce for red snapper is a basic lemon sauce. A basic lemon sauce is a simple mixture of lemon juice, zest, and butter. It is a great way to add a burst of flavor to any dish, and it is particularly good on red snapper.

To make a basic lemon sauce, simply mix together lemon juice, zest, and butter. You can add other ingredients if you want, such as garlic or herbs, but the basic recipe is all you need to make a great lemon sauce for red snapper.

Caper and Lemon Sauce

The best lemon sauce for red snapper is a caper and lemon sauce. It’s a simple recipe that’s easy to make, and it’s a great way to add a fresh, bright flavor to your fish. Plus, it’s low in calories and high in protein, making it a healthy choice for those who are watching their weight.

To make the sauce, simply combine capers, lemon juice, and olive oil. Let the mixture sit for a few minutes so that the flavors can meld together. Then, serve it over your red snapper.

The Ultimate Guide To Finding The Perfect Lemon Sauce For Red Snapper

When choosing a lemon sauce for red snapper, consider the ingredients and how they will complement the fish. A light and refreshing sauce is best, as the fish is delicate in flavor.

Consider the thickness of the sauce. A thicker sauce will work better with a firm fish like red snapper, while a thinner sauce may be more suitable for a softer fish.

Choose a sauce that is not too acidic. Red snapper is a mild-tasting fish, and a too-acidic sauce can overpower the flavor.

Consider the amount of heat in the sauce. Red snapper is a mild-tasting fish, and a spicy sauce may not be the best choice.

Choose a sauce that is not too sweet. Red snapper is a savory fish, and a sweet sauce may not be the best choice.
